What It Means for NVDA
NVIDIA’s Vera Rubin architecture is significantly more powerful than its previous Blackwell line — but power comes with a physical price. The VR200 NVL72 rack costs hyperscalers roughly $7.8 million, nearly double the prior generation, with PCB content alone surging from $35,000 to $116,700 per cabinet. Six raw materials sit at the bottleneck of that manufacturing chain. All six are in structural shortage stretching into 2027.
A 233% increase in PCB BOM forces NVIDIA to absorb costs or test the price elasticity of hyperscalers running tight CapEx budgets. Pricing power is real — but not infinite at $7.8M per rack.
Rubin shipment share revised from 29% to 22% for late 2026. T-glass cloth and M9 resin constraints are the primary causes. This is a quarter-delay, not a cancellation. Demand is intact.
A single defective layer in a 26-layer HDI board can invalidate an entire NVL72 cabinet. NVIDIA is increasingly behaving as an industrial conglomerate — directly intervening in raw material allocation.
The two primary Taiwanese PCB and substrate names — Unimicron (3037.TW, ~NT$968) and Nan Ya PCB (8046, ~NT$819) — are already running at effective capacity ceilings locked to NVIDIA and AMD.
